TSS - Threshold Secret Sharing

A Ruby implementation of Threshold Secret Sharing (Shamir) as defined in IETF Internet-Draft draft-mcgrew-tss-03.txt (by grempe)

Clamby

ClamAV interface to your Ruby on Rails project. (by kobaltz)
